    Website. audacy.com /kfrog. KFRG (95.1 FM) is a commercial radio station licensed to San Bernardino, California, and broadcasting to the Riverside -San Bernardino- Inland Empire radio market. KFRG airs a country music radio format calling itself "K- FROG " and is believed to be the original "Frog" station under previous owner Keymarket.

    Listen live (via Audacy) Website. audacy .com /kfrog. KXFG (92.9 FM) is a commercial country music radio station in Menifee, California, broadcasting to the Temecula area. KXFG is a simulcast of KFRG in San Bernardino, California. Its studios are in Colton and the transmitter site for KXFG is in Murrieta . KXFG broadcasts and HD Radio signal. [3]

    Website. 935kday.com. KDAY (93.5 FM, "93.5 KDAY") is a radio station that is licensed to Redondo Beach, California and serves the Greater Los Angeles area. The station is owned by Meruelo Media and airs a classic hip hop format. The station's studios are located in Burbank and its transmitter is in Baldwin Hills.

    KUSC (91.5 FM; "Classical California KUSC") is a listener-supported classical music radio station broadcasting from downtown Los Angeles, California, United States. [2] KUSC is owned and operated by the University of Southern California, which also operates student-run Internet station KXSC (AM) and San Francisco's classical station KDFC.
